Regina Landry
Regina Landry ran for election for an at-large seat of the Hickman Mills C-1 Board of Education in Missouri. She did not appear on the ballot for the general election on April 2, 2019.

General election for Hickman Mills C-1 School District Board of Education (2 seats)
Tramise Carter and John Carmichael defeated Cecil Wattree in the general election for Hickman Mills C-1 School District Board of Education on April 2, 2019.
Candidate | % | Votes | ||
| ✔ | Tramise Carter (Nonpartisan) | 34.9 | 1,250 | |
| ✔ | John Carmichael (Nonpartisan) | 31.8 | 1,140 | |
| Cecil Wattree (Nonpartisan) | 29.2 | 1,045 | ||
| Other/Write-in votes | 4.1 | 145 | ||
| Total votes: 3,580 | ||||
